Fadnavis Warns Action Over Ranveer Allahbadia’s Remarks Amid Roast Show Row

Mumbai, 10th Feb.
 Amid growing outrage over YouTuber and podcaster Ranveer Allahbadia’s remarks on a roast show, Maharashtra Chief Minister Devendra Fadnavis has warned that anyone crossing the limits of decency will face action. The Chief Minister stated that while he had not watched the viral clip, he was informed that it was “very vulgar” and unacceptable.

“Everyone has freedom of speech, but this freedom ends when we encroach upon others’ rights. If anyone crosses the limits, action will be taken,” Fadnavis said.

The controversy erupted after a clip from the show India’s Got Latent went viral, featuring Allahbadia—popularly known as BeerBiceps—posing an inappropriate question to a contestant. Two Mumbai lawyers, Ashish Rai and Pankaj Mishra, have filed a police complaint against Allahbadia and other comedians, including Samay Raina and Apoorva Makhija, alleging that their remarks were vulgar and disrespectful towards women.

The complaint, submitted to Mumbai Police Commissioner Vivek Phalsankar and the Maharashtra State Women’s Commission, demands an FIR against the show’s creators and its shutdown. The lawyers argue that the show promotes indecency for financial gain and negatively influences young minds.

The incident has sparked widespread backlash on social media. Journalist and lyricist Neelesh Misra criticized the platform’s creators for lacking responsibility. “Decency is not incentivized in India—platforms and audiences are rewarding crass content,” Misra posted on X.

Congress leader Supriya Shrinate also condemned the show, calling the remarks “perverse, not creative.” She expressed concern that such comments were being normalized under the guise of comedy.

With pressure mounting, authorities may soon take action against the show’s organizers.
